Closing the loop on food waste: Livestock as the ultimate upcyclers

Ruminant animals aren’t just great at turning grass and forage into nutrient-dense protein; they can also turn food waste back into food, but we need a system to do it. Dr. Kim Ominski, with the University of Manitoba, Dr. Tim McAllister, with Agriculture and Agri-Food Canada at Lethbridge, and Herman Peters, of Birkland Farms, join Shaun Haney for this webinar on integrating livestock systems into our food system on the post-consumer and processor end in a wide-scale effort to decrease food waste and recycle nutrients.
